XenOnSargeHowto » Cronologia » Versione 2
Versione 1 (Amministratore Truelite, 24-02-2006 12:23) → Versione 2/12 (Amministratore Truelite, 24-02-2006 12:43)
= Come creare un server di virtualizzazione usando Xen su una Debian Sarge = Si considerino i presenti requisiti di base: * una distribuzione linux debian, release Sarge, installata; * una buona quantità di spazio su disco libero su una partizione; * almeno due interfacce di rete (eth0, eth1); * una quantità di memoria ram maggiore o uguale a 512MB. Il primo passo è l'installazione del kernel xen e dei relativi tool che vanno presi da un repository esterno in quanto non presenti in sarge. I seguenti comandi abilitano il repository esterno ed installano i pacchetti necessari. {{{ echo "deb http://packages.debianbase.de/sarge/i386/xen3 ./" >> /etc/apt/sources.list apt-get update apt-get install xen udev hotplug bridge-utils linux-xen0-2.6 cd /usr/src dpkg -i kernel-xen0-2.6.12.6-xen_tha1_i386.deb }}} Una volta installati i pacchetti, è necessario rigenerare l'initrd per il vostro sistema con il comando {{{ mkinitrd -o /boot/xen-modules-2.6.12.6-xen 2.6.12.6-xen }}} e successivamente aggiungere a grub le voci necessarie per fare il boot con il kernel xen. {{{ # # Put static boot stanzas before and/or after AUTOMAGIC KERNEL LIST title Xen 3.0.1 - Linux 2.6.12.6-xen kernel /boot/xen-3.0.1.gz vga=791 module /boot/xen-linux-2.6.12.6-xen root=/dev/hda1 ro module /boot/xen-modules-2.6.12.6-xen }}}